Position Overview

Cardinal Financial is a nationwide direct mortgage lender that focuses on creating solutions for borrowers, partners, and employees. We value innovation, integrity, and exceptional customer service. In this role, you will educate customers on company values, processes, and operations; obtain and compile information for loan applications; explain available loan options; and ensure outstanding customer service while adhering to federal, local, and internal guidelines.

Key Responsibilities

  • Analyze applicants' financial status, credit, and property evaluations to determine the feasibility of granting loans.
  • Obtain and compile copies of loan applicants' credit histories, corporate financial statements, and other financial information.
  • Explain to customers the different types of loans and credit options available, including the terms of those services.
  • Review loan agreements to ensure they are complete and accurate according to company policies, guidelines, compliance, and lending regulations.
  • Maintain customer confidence by keeping all loan information confidential.
  • Maintain licenses and compliance by participating in required continuing education courses.
  • Collaborate with sales, processing, underwriting, closing, post-closing, and management to ensure the customer receives excellent service.
  • Originated your own sales by contacting prospective clients and developing and monitoring referral sources.
  • Meet clients outside of the employer's place of business to initiate sales.
  • Spend significant time away from the employer's location meeting prospective customers at various sites, including clients' homes and other referral sources.
  • Meet specific goals and requirements by division: Phone/Talk Time, Locked Loans, Funded Loans, Realtor Visits, Applications, and Credit Pulls.
  • Achieve standard pull-through rates and complete accurate loan applications.
  • Meet attendance, punctuality, and other company standards while abiding by all company policies and procedures.

Required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ED is preferred.
  • Minimum of one (1) year experience working as a Loan Originator is required.
  • Must possess, or have the ability to possess upon hire, a Mortgage Loan Originator (MLO) license per the SAFE Act; may be asked to become licensed in multiple states.
  • Solid foundation of mortgage experience.
  • Exceptional customer service skills.
  • Ability to adapt well to change.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ple demands and competing priorities in a fast-paced environment.
